The PhD in Intelligent Systems and Data Science (ISDS) at Brock University is a thesis-based, interdisciplinary doctorate combining advanced AI, machine learning, and data-driven statistical methods. It is designed for researchers who want to build intelligent software and analytics systems grounded in rigorous mathematics and statistics.

Graduates of the PhD program in Intelligent Systems and Data Science are well-equipped for advanced careers in academia, industry, and research institutions. They can pursue roles such as data scientists, machine learning engineers, AI researchers, and analytics consultants, contributing to innovative projects that leverage intelligent systems and big data analytics.
